Job Responsibilities:

  • Continually monitor bottle quality to ensure customer satisfaction
  • Perform hourly leak detector and vision system checks using the designated test bottles
  • Perform the following tests for all lines as per the required frequency listed in the control plan:
  • Finish measurements (i.e. T, E, ID, S, etc.)
  • Wall thickness
  • Top load
  • Bottle height and panel widths
  • Drop impact test
  • Weight
  • Visual and bottle integrity inspections
  • Volume and overflow
  • Filled bottle leak test * Notify the Machine Operator and Production Supervisor when tests are out of specification limits. Stay on top of the out of specification conditions until corrected
  • Proficient at using the following equipment:
  • Caliper
  • Scale
  • AVBIS 3000
  • Magna Mike
  • Height Gage
  • Top Load Tester * Basic ability to troubleshoot testing equipment when there’s a failure
  • Challenge the leak detector and vision systems hourly with the designated test bottles
  • Perform line inspections at the required frequencies. Notify the Machine Operator and Production Supervisor of any defect product found
  • Responsible for placing nonconforming product on hold, tagging each pallet, and ensuring the product is isolated and moved to the designated hold area
  • When placing product on hold, check pallets until the start of the defective condition is found. This may require inspecting pallets from previous shifts or bringing back trailers that have already left the building
  • Work with machine operators, supervisors, etc. to correct defective conditions
  • Proficient with the RealSPC software. Able to create tests, enter data and view historical data and charts
  • Maintain defect storyboards for each line
  • Issue new specification sheets for production personnel at product changeovers
  • Conduct FAI (first article inspection) on new product, new molds, and at line start-ups
  • Complete quality records neatly and legibly
  • Maintain quality records
  • Complete cleaning assignments per the master cleaning schedule
  • Communicate all relevant information at shift changeover (product placed on hold, ongoing quality issues, machine status, etc.)
